About This Book

The Badlands Series is the spellbinding account of the trials and tribulations of a larger-than-life underground criminal organization extending to New York, Philadelphia, and D.C, over the last two decades. Their combined power extends from the wildest neighborhood blocks to the most conservative corridors of local government. Like a living urban legend, these tales of ruthless superiority captured the minds and hearts of even their sworn enemies.

In A Love To Die For, Victor, a reformed gangster, is released from prison with revenge on his mind and news that his cousin has been murdered. He vows to avenge his murder and to take care of his niece, Isabella. Angelica, his one true love, wants nothing to do with him. Eventually, Victor finds himself caught in a dangerous wild goose chase that ensues between a union boss, Sean Flannery’s Irish crew of gangsters, and Jorge Â"Fieta” Santiago’s Crown organization and soon learns that everything has a price and must be forced to make a choice when this explosive situation puts Angelica’s life at risk. To save his one true love, Victor must make the right moves to stay in the game – this is chess not checkers.
